A/C Condenser Replacement Cost: Budget Guide

A/C condenser replacement typically costs between $800 and $2,500 for most domestic and import vehicles, with labor accounting for a substantial portion of the bill. When your air conditioning system fails mid-summer, understanding the cost breakdown ahead of time helps you make informed decisions about whether to repair now, delay, or explore your options. This guide walks you through typical pricing, what drives variation, and strategies to keep costs manageable without sacrificing quality or safety.

Average A/C Condenser and Receiver Drier Assembly Replacement Cost

For most vehicles, expect to pay between $800 and $2,500 for complete A/C condenser and receiver drier assembly replacement, including both parts and labor. The wide range reflects real differences in vehicle complexity, regional labor rates, and whether you choose aftermarket or OEM components. A sedan with straightforward condenser access and a regional independent shop might run $900–$1,400, while a truck with a turbocharged engine, tight engine bay, and dealership labor could easily exceed $2,000. Geographic location matters too: urban dealerships and shops in high cost-of-living areas typically charge 20–40% more than rural independent shops. Always request a detailed written estimate before approving work, as quoted prices should account for your specific vehicle and local labor market conditions.

Cost Breakdown: Parts vs Labor

Item Budget Range Mid-Range Premium
A/C Condenser (Aftermarket) $150–$300 $300–$450 $450–$650
A/C Condenser (OEM) $400–$700 $700–$1,000 $1,000–$1,500
Receiver Drier $40–$80 $80–$150 $150–$250
Labor (Typical 2–4 Hours) $240–$720 $360–$1,000 $500–$1,400

Labor time and shop rates vary significantly by vehicle design and regional pricing. A compact sedan with good access might take 2 hours at an independent shop, while a truck with the condenser mounted in a tight space could require 4+ hours or carry premium labor rates at a dealership. Always confirm the estimated labor hours and hourly rate before work begins.

Factors That Affect the Price

  • Vehicle make, model, and engine size: Engine bay layout determines how accessible the condenser is. Vehicles with cramped engine bays, larger displacement engines, or turbocharged setups require more disassembly time, pushing labor costs higher. Front-wheel-drive sedans typically cost less to service than rear-wheel-drive trucks or high-performance vehicles.
  • OEM versus aftermarket parts: Original equipment manufacturer condensers typically cost 2–3 times more than aftermarket alternatives but may carry longer warranties and exact fitment. Aftermarket parts from reputable suppliers offer reliable performance at lower cost, making them a practical choice for budget-conscious owners willing to trade brand prestige for value.
  • Shop labor rates and location: Independent repair shops in rural or smaller markets often charge $120–$180 per hour, while urban independent shops and dealerships typically charge $180–$350 per hour. Your region's cost of living and local competition directly influence the quote you receive.
  • Receiver drier replacement: The receiver drier is almost always replaced alongside the condenser to remove moisture and contaminants from the system. Skipping this component to save $50–$150 risks future compressor damage and repeat repairs, making it a false economy.
  • Additional discoveries during service: Sometimes diagnosis reveals secondary issues such as damaged refrigerant hoses, compressor problems, or expansion valve failures. These add $200–$800 or more to the final bill. Request an itemized estimate and ask the shop to call you before proceeding with unexpected repairs.

Can You DIY This Repair?

A/C condenser replacement is a medium-to-high difficulty repair that requires specialized knowledge, tools, and EPA certification for refrigerant handling. The core challenge is that refrigerant is a regulated substance—draining, evacuating, and recharging the system legally requires EPA 608 certification, which most DIY enthusiasts don't hold. Beyond the regulatory hurdle, you'll need a vacuum pump, refrigerant recovery equipment, torque wrench, and precise torque specifications for condenser mounting and fitting connections. Improper evacuation can leave moisture in the system and damage the compressor; incorrect torque can cause refrigerant leaks or system damage. These are not beginner repairs. If you're an experienced DIYer with access to proper equipment and your vehicle's service manual, the basic steps involve depressurizing the system, disconnecting refrigerant lines, unbolting the condenser, installing the new unit, and evacuating and recharging the system. However, the general guidance here is not a substitute for your vehicle's specific repair procedures, torque specs, and refrigerant capacity data—you must consult your owner's manual and factory service documentation. For most owners, professional service is the safest, most reliable path forward. Having a certified mechanic handle or inspect your work protects against costly compressor damage and ensures your system operates safely and efficiently.

How to Save Money on A/C Condenser and Receiver Drier Assembly Replacement

  • Get multiple quotes: Contact at least two independent repair shops, your dealership, and a national chain service center. You'll discover price variation of $300–$800 or more for the same repair. Compare the parts used, labor hours, and warranty terms to ensure fair pricing.
  • Consider quality aftermarket parts: Reputable aftermarket condensers deliver reliable cooling performance at 40–60% less cost than OEM equivalents. Look for parts backed by solid warranties (1–3 years minimum) and positive customer feedback to balance savings with durability.
  • Ask about warranties upfront: Some shops bundle 12-month or 24-month warranties on both parts and labor; others offer lifetime warranties on certain aftermarket components. A slightly higher upfront cost may be justified if it includes extended coverage against defects or installation errors.
  • Bundle additional A/C service: If your compressor, expansion valve, or refrigerant hoses need attention, ask whether performing multiple services together reduces total labor time or qualifies for package pricing. Bundling can shave 10–20% off the overall bill.

Signs You Need to Replace Your A/C Condenser Now

  • Warm air blowing from the vents: If your A/C compressor is running but the system blows warm or barely cool air, the condenser may not be rejecting heat properly. This happens when fins are clogged, the condenser is damaged, or refrigerant pressure has dropped. Have a mechanic check pressure and inspect the condenser visually.
  • Visible refrigerant leaks or oil residue: Look under your vehicle for wet spots, oily streaks, or puddles near the front of the engine bay where the condenser sits. Refrigerant leaks indicate failed seals or corrosion and will worsen over time, eventually damaging the compressor if left unaddressed.
  • Hissing or bubbling sounds: Unusual noises from the A/C compressor area or dashboard vents suggest refrigerant is escaping. These sounds indicate system pressure loss and warrant immediate professional diagnosis to prevent compressor failure.
  • Bent, cracked, or severely clogged fins: Examine the condenser's aluminum fins (the radiator-like grid at the front of your car). Road debris, corrosion, or impact damage can bend or crack fins, reducing cooling efficiency. Minor fin damage can sometimes be straightened, but extensive damage requires condenser replacement.
